Fabjan Pepaj is an Italian Albanian author, journalist and leader in children’s residential care based in London. He began working in television journalism at fifteen, later studied international affairs, media and politics at the University of Bologna, contributed to strategic policy work at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Kosovo and developed a leadership career in children’s care in England. His books explore Albanian, Italian and European history and identity, public life, leadership and therapeutic care. He writes to preserve cultural memory, make complex ideas accessible and turn professional experience into practical wisdom.
